Understanding Legal Compliance and Player Protection

Legal compliance in the online casino industry is not just a matter of following rules; it is a framework that provides security and assurance to players. Licensed providers must adhere to strict regulations and standards set by regulatory authorities. This legal approval ensures that games offered by verified studios are fair and transparent, promoting trust in the gambling environment.

Players are safeguarded through measures established by regulations that require operators to implement responsible gambling practices. These practices may include self-exclusion tools, age verification processes, and limits on deposit amounts, fostering a safe gaming experience.

Game licensing serves as a seal of quality and integrity. Players can rest assured that games produced by licensed providers are subjected to thorough testing and audits. This oversight prevents fraudulent activities and ensures that players’ rights are protected, creating a balanced atmosphere for enjoyment and competition.

In addition to protecting players, compliance with legal standards helps operators maintain their reputation. Failure to follow regulations can lead to hefty fines and loss of licenses, which affects their ability to operate. Thus, both players and operators benefit from a regulated environment that prioritizes fairness and security.
